1.2 THE PRESENT CONTINUOUS / Exercises


Put the verbs in brackets into the present continuous:

1) I (to do) ___________ my homework.
2) Ann (to sit) _________ at  her desk.
3) John and his friends (to go) _________________to the library.
4) The old man (to walk) ___________in the park.
5) We (to cook) __________ dinner. My mother (to make) ___________ a salad.
6) My grandfather (to read) ___________________ a newspaper.
7) _____ the doctor and her patient (to talk) ____________?
8) _____ Nancy (to paint) _________ her kitchen?
9) _____ the boys (to run) ________ about the garden?
10) _____ Jack (to talk) __________to his friend?
11) _____ Nancy (to drink) _________tea with her mother?
12) _____ your little brother (to sleep) _____________?
13) It (be) ____________ snowing. (NEGATIVE)
14) I (to work) ________________ this week. I’m on holiday.(NEGATIVE)
15) My sister (read) ______________ at the moment.(NEGATIVE)
16) We can come right now because we (watch) __________________ TV.(NEGATIVE)
17) Boys (play) _________________ football in the garden now.(NEGATIVE)
